New Delhi | April 11, 2026 — Prime Minister Narendra Modi today led the nation in paying rich tributes to the iconic social reformer Mahatma Jyotirao Phule on his birth anniversary. This year’s commemoration holds special significance as it marks the official commencement of the 200th birth anniversary celebrations of the visionary leader.
A Visionary for Equality and Education
Describing Phule as a “guiding light,” the Prime Minister highlighted his life’s work dedicated to justice, equality, and the empowerment of the marginalized. He specifically noted Phule’s pioneering role in championing women’s rights and his transformative belief that education is the most powerful tool for social change.

Message of Inspiration
Sharing his thoughts in multiple languages on X, the Prime Minister prayed that Phule’s ideals would continue to guide the nation.
“On the birth anniversary of Mahatma Jyotirao Phule, paying tributes to a visionary social reformer who dedicated his life to the ideals of equality, justice and education… May his thoughts continue to guide everyone in the pursuit of societal progress.” — PM Narendra Modi
The year-long celebrations are expected to include various national programs aimed at honoring Phule’s contributions to Indian society and his role in the socio-educational revolution.
